20 Brands Like Furla for Chic, Italian Handbags
If you're a fan of chic, well-made Italian handbags, you probably already have a special place in your heart for Furla. The brand has mastered the art of creating bags that feel both timeless and modern, with structured shapes, gorgeous colors, and high-quality leather that doesn’t require a second mortgage. Furla hits that perfect sweet spot between everyday practicality and accessible luxury.
For those who love Furla's sophisticated Italian style but want to expand their collection, there are many other amazing brands that offer a similar blend of quality, craftsmanship, and European flair. Here are 20 brands like Furla to add to your radar.
1. Coccinelle

Coccinelle is the effortlessly cool, minimalist sister to Furla. Known for its sleek designs and high-quality leather, this Italian brand creates functional, chic shapes that are perfect for everyday elegance. Their bags, which typically range from $200 to $600, are all about understated sophistication - think clean lines and subtle details. If you admire Furla's craftsmanship but prefer a slightly more toned-down aesthetic, Coccinelle is a perfect match.
2. Liu Jo

For a more playful and trend-driven take on Italian chic, look no further than Liu Jo. With bags typically priced between $150 and $500, they offer bold colors, fun logo accents, and of-the-moment shapes. While Furla leans into timeless elegance, Liu Jo isn't afraid to have a little fun. It's a great option if you want Furla's quality but with a more youthful, fashion-forward twist.
3. Valentino by Mario Valentino

Blending iconic style with more accessible prices ($400-$1,200), Valentino by Mario Valentino delivers a dose of high-fashion glamour. Known for chic silhouettes and their signature stud embellishments, these bags have a bit more edge than Furla's classic designs. If you love a sophisticated bag but crave a little rock-and-roll attitude, this is the brand for you.
4. Pinko

Pinko is for the fashion lover who wants her accessories to make a statement. This contemporary Italian brand is known for its edgy, eye-catching handbags featuring the iconic "Love Birds" buckle. With prices from $150 to $600, you’ll find bold prints, cool embellishments, and innovative shapes. Where Furla is sophisticated and refined, Pinko is fearless and fun, offering similar quality with a much bigger personality.
5. Zanellato

If you're looking to invest in a true piece of Italian craftsmanship, Zanellato is a beautiful choice. Famous for their iconic Postina bag, this brand focuses on luxurious, handcrafted leather goods that scream timeless elegance. Their bags hover in the $800 to $2,500 range, making them a step up from Furla. Consider Zanellato for an heirloom-quality bag that you will cherish forever.
6. Serapian

Serapian is all about quiet, artisanal luxury. This Milanese brand is celebrated for its incredibly soft, supple leathers and sophisticated, under-the-radar designs. Priced from $1,200 to $4,000, these bags are for those who appreciate meticulous craftsmanship over flashy logos. While Furla brings the color and contemporary fun, Serapian offers pure, timeless refinement.
7. Gattinoni
Gattinoni delivers traditional Italian elegance with a touch of vintage charm. Focusing on classic, feminine silhouettes, their bags often feature refined details and sophisticated shapes. Price-wise, they are similar to Furla, typically between $300 and $900. While both share a proud Italian heritage, Gattinoni leans more towards classic, romantic designs that feel timeless.
8. Moynat

Known for its exquisite French craftsmanship and sleek, structured handbags, Moynat is a true high-luxury name. With prices starting around $2,000, their bags are investment pieces for connoisseurs of artisanal work. Compared to Furla's accessible luxury, Moynat operates in a different league, offering timeless elegance and meticulous leatherwork that quietly signals ultimate good taste.
9. Laura Biagiotti
This iconic Italian label is loved for its elegant, functional, and oh-so-soft leather bags. Priced from $200 to $700, Laura Biagiotti offers bags that are versatile, chic, and perfect for daily wear. Like Furla, the focus is on quality and effortless style, but with a slightly more relaxed and timeless vibe that makes them incredibly easy to wear.
10. Valextra

Valextra represents the pinnacle of minimalist, under-the-radar Italian luxury. Famous for architectural shapes and supreme quality, their logo-free designs are for those who are confident in their style. With prices starting at $2,500, it’s a significant splurge compared to Furla. Think of Valextra as a purse for those "if you know, you know" moments of quiet luxury.
11. Bric's
Best known for its incredibly stylish and durable travel gear, Bric's also offers fantastic everyday bags. Priced from $150 to $600, their designs are famously practical, often using lightweight, water-resistant materials. While Furla has the handbag market cornered, Bric's is your go-to for durable, chic accessories that carry that same signature Italian flair, especially for travel.
12. Piquadro
For the professional who demands both style and function, Piquadro is the answer. This Italian brand specializes in sleek leather backpacks, totes, and accessories designed for the modern, tech-savvy world. They share Furla’s commitment to Italian craftsmanship but place a stronger emphasis on organizational compartments and practicality for your devices. Prices generally range from $200-$700.
13. Sergio Rossi

While legendary for its exquisite shoes, Sergio Rossi’s handbag collections are not to be overlooked. Mirroring the footwear's luxurious and feminine aesthetic, their bags are sleek, refined, and beautifully made, with prices around $500 to $1,200. It’s an ideal choice if you appreciate Furla’s polished feel and love the idea of a perfectly coordinated shoe and bag moment.
14. Pura Lopez
Pura Lopez excels in chic, minimalist handbags with clean lines and buttery-smooth leather. This Spanish brand understands the power of a timeless silhouette, creating essentials perfect for the woman who loves effortless style. They occupy a similar price point to Furla ($300-$800) but stand out for their sleek, understated luxury and impeccable craftsmanship.
15. Bottega Veneta

Instantly recognizable for its signature intrecciato woven leather, Bottega Veneta is a gold standard of discreet Italian luxury. The brand’s artful, logo-free designs speak for themselves, commanding prices that start around $2,500. It's a significant step-up from Furla, appealing to those who want a bag that is both a status symbol and an art object.
16. Trussardi
Trussardi offers a cool, sporty-chic take on Italian luxury. In a similar price range to Furla ($300-$900), their bags often fuse modern shapes with subtle logo accents, striking a balance between elegance and a contemporary, urban edge. If your style is sophisticated but with a casual twist, Trussardi’s collection will feel right at home.
17. Etro

Famous for its vibrant paisley prints and bohemian flair, Etro is for lovers of color and personality. Where Furla offers classic solids and structured shapes, Etro explodes with artistic patterns and rich embroidery. Their bags are true statement pieces, ranging from $400 to $1,200, perfect for anyone whose style mantra is "more is more."
18. Salvatore Ferragamo
Synonymous with timeless Italian elegance, Ferragamo is a heritage brand that exudes luxury. Known for its iconic Gancini hardware and immaculate craftsmanship, Ferragamo bags offer a more high-end, classic aesthetic than Furla, with prices ranging from $600 to $2,000. It's an investment in quality and a rich history of Italian design.
19. Miu Miu

As Prada's playful and rebellious younger sister, Miu Miu serves up trendy, statement-making handbags. The brand is known for its bold designs, quirky embellishments, and a fun, youthful energy that contrasts with Furla's timeless classicism. With bags from $600 to $2,000, it's the perfect choice for fashion-forward women who want their accessories to be the center of attention.
20. Antonelli
Antonelli is for the purist who values handcrafted details and artisanal techniques above all else. Crafted in Florence, their luxurious leather handbags emphasize timeless shapes and exquisite finishes, with prices typically starting around $1,000. It's a high-end alternative to Furla for someone seeking an investment-quality piece built on tradition and heirloom-worthy craftsmanship.
